如何允许域用户访问 EC2 实例上的 SQL Server 实例?

1 分钟阅读
0

我想以域用户身份访问 Amazon Elastic Compute Cloud(Amazon EC2)实例上的 SQL Server 实例。

简述

默认情况下,只有内置的本地管理员账户可以访问从 Amazon Web Services(AWS)Windows AMI 启动的 SQL Server 实例。您可以使用 SQL Server Management Studio(SSMS)添加域用户,以便他们可以访问和管理 SQL Server。

解决方案

要授予域用户访问 SQL Server 实例的权限,请执行以下步骤:

  1. 以本地管理员身份使用远程桌面协议(RDP)连接到您的实例
  2. 打开 SSMS。对于身份验证,选择 Windows 身份验证,以便使用内置的本地管理员登录。
  3. 选择连接
  4. 在对象资源管理器中,展开安全
  5. 打开登录的上下文(右键单击)菜单,然后选择新建登录
  6. 对于登录名,选择 Windows 身份验证。输入域名\用户名,将域名替换为您的域 NetBIOS 名称,将用户名替换为您的 Active Directory 用户名。
  7. 服务器角色页面上,选择要授予该 Active Directory 用户的服务器角色。有关更多信息,请参阅 Microsoft Ignite 网站上的服务器级别角色
  8. 选择常规页面,然后选择确定
  9. 从相关实例上注销,然后以域用户身份再次登录。
  10. 打开 SSMS。对于身份验证,选择 Windows 身份验证,以便使用您的域用户账户登录。
  11. 选择连接

**注意:**执行这些步骤将允许该用户访问 SQL Server 表。

相关信息

教程: Amazon EC2 Windows 实例入门

排查 EC2 Windows 实例的问题

AWS 官方
AWS 官方已更新 2 年前